人β-NGF重组质粒转染GFP转基因小鼠BMSC的实验研究 被引量:2

Experimental study on transfection of humanβ-NGF recombinant plasmid into BMSCs of GFP transgenic mouse

摘要 目的观察携带有人β神经生长因子(β-NGF)重组质粒的骨髓基质干细胞(BMSC)的生物学特性。方法培养小鼠BMSC,采用脂质体LipofectamineTM2000(Lip2000)转染方法将含有人β-NGF基因的重组质粒转染至含有绿色荧光蛋白(GFP)基因的小鼠BMSC中,利用酶联免疫吸附测定(ELISA)的方法检测其β-NGF蛋白的表达水平。结果采用脂质体Lip2000转染方法能成功地将β-NGF重组质粒转染至BMSC,转染后细胞出现β-NGF基因的表达,并且其表达的β-NGF蛋白能有效地保护转染过程中对细胞的损害。结论经转染后携带β-NGF基因质粒的小鼠BMSC仍有增殖、分化能力,并且具有了β-NGF蛋白的表达能力。 Objective To investigate the biological features of the mouse bone marrow stromal stem cells (BMSCs) transfected by humanβnerve growth factor(β-NGF) .Methods BMSCs of GFP transgenic mouse were isolated and cultured .Theβ-NGF re-combinant plasmid vectors were transferred into the cultured BMSCs by LipofectamineTM 2000 .The expression of β-NGF was detec-ted with ELISA .Results The β-NGF recombinant plasmid vectors were successfully transferred into BMSCs of GFP transgenic mouse ,the expression of β-NGF in transfected cells appeared .In addition ,the expression ofβ-NGF could effectively protect the BM-SCs which were injured in transfection process .Conclusion BMSCs of GFP transgenic mouse after transfecton with human β-NGF have the proliferation and differentiation capacity ,and possess the expression ability of β-NGF protein .
